About William Hill

William Hill, a name synonymous with betting, traces its origins back to 1934, when it was founded by William Hill himself in the United Kingdom. Initially operating through postal and telephone betting services, the company rapidly expanded its footprint, establishing retail betting shops across the UK. Over the decades, it has evolved into a multinational enterprise, adapting to technological advancements and regulatory changes within the global gambling landscape. The brand has a strong presence in its home market of the UK, but also serves various international jurisdictions, subject to local licensing and regulations. Its long history contributes to its brand recognition and perceived reliability among a broad demographic of bettors. The company has navigated numerous shifts in consumer behavior and technological innovation, consistently maintaining a significant share in the competitive online betting market.

Features and Betting Options

William Hill offers a robust and diverse range of betting and gaming products designed to cater to a wide audience. Its primary offering is a comprehensive sportsbook, covering an extensive array of sports from around the globe. Users can place wagers on popular sports such as football, horse racing, tennis, basketball, and American sports like NFL and NBA, alongside more niche events and categories. The depth of markets available for individual events is considerable, encompassing standard win/lose bets, handicaps, over/under totals, and various prop bets. This extensive coverage ensures that both casual bettors and seasoned punters can find suitable betting opportunities.

Beyond traditional sports betting, William Hill also operates a substantial online casino. This section features a wide selection of games, including classic slot machines, video slots, progressive jackpots, and an array of table games such such as roulette, blackjack, baccarat, and poker variations. The casino games are typically sourced from reputable software providers, ensuring fair play and high-quality graphics and sound. A significant part of the casino offering is the live casino, where players can engage with real dealers in real-time, replicating the authentic casino experience from the comfort of their homes or mobile devices. This interactive element adds a layer of immersion and social engagement that many players appreciate.

Live betting, also known as in-play betting, is a core feature of William Hill’s sportsbook. This allows users to place bets on events as they unfold, with odds dynamically updating based on the real-time action. The platform provides a rich selection of live betting markets across numerous sports, often accompanied by live statistics and sometimes even live streaming services for selected events. This dynamic betting environment appeals to users who enjoy making informed decisions based on the flow of a game.

Mobile accessibility is another critical component of the William Hill experience. The platform offers dedicated mobile applications for both iOS and Android devices, providing a streamlined and optimized betting interface. These apps typically mirror the full functionality of the desktop site, allowing users to place bets, manage their accounts, deposit funds, and withdraw winnings on the go. The design of the mobile apps is often focused on intuitive navigation and quick access to popular markets, enhancing convenience for mobile users.

Licensing and Security

William Hill operates under strict regulatory oversight, holding licenses from several prominent gambling authorities globally. The primary licenses include those from the UK Gambling Commission (UKGC) and the Gibraltar Gambling Commissioner. These licenses are highly respected within the industry and signify that William Hill adheres to rigorous standards for fair play, player protection, and responsible gambling. For operations in other jurisdictions, William Hill often obtains specific local licenses, such as those from the Malta Gaming Authority or various state-level bodies in the United States, depending on where it offers its services.

Security is a cornerstone of William Hill’s operations. The platform employs advanced encryption technologies, such as SSL (Secure Socket Layer) encryption, to protect all data transmitted between users and its servers. This ensures that personal and financial information remains confidential and secure from unauthorized access. Regular security audits are conducted by independent third-parties to assess and enhance the robustness of its systems. Furthermore, William Hill is committed to responsible gambling, providing various tools and resources to help users manage their betting activity, including deposit limits, self-exclusion options, and links to support organizations. The company’s long-standing reputation and adherence to strict regulatory frameworks reinforce its commitment to maintaining a secure and trustworthy betting environment.

Payment Methods

William Hill supports a comprehensive array of payment methods to facilitate convenient deposits and withdrawals for its diverse customer base. The availability of specific options can vary based on the user’s geographical location and local regulations, but a broad range is typically offered.

Common deposit methods include major credit and debit cards such as Visa, Mastercard, and sometimes Maestro. E-wallets are a popular choice due to their speed and security, with options often including PayPal, Skrill, Neteller, and ecoPayz. Bank transfers are also available, providing a direct method for moving funds, though these can sometimes take longer to process. Additionally, prepaid vouchers like Paysafecard offer an option for users who prefer not to use bank accounts or cards directly. Some regions may also support local payment solutions specific to those markets.

For withdrawals, many of the same methods are available, typically prioritizing the method used for deposit, in line with anti-money laundering regulations. E-wallet withdrawals are generally the fastest, often processed within hours or up to a day. Credit/debit card withdrawals and bank transfers usually take longer, ranging from 3 to 5 business days, sometimes more depending on the banking institution. William Hill generally does not charge fees for deposits or withdrawals, but users should verify this and be aware of any potential charges from their chosen payment provider. Minimum and maximum transaction limits are usually in place and are clearly communicated within the banking section of the platform.
